Pathway Pouring in Fort Collins, CO
Pathway pouring services involve the installation of concrete walkways, sidewalks, patios, and other similar surfaces on residential properties. This service covers a variety of projects, including creating new pathways for improved access, repairing or replacing existing walkways, and adding decorative concrete features to enhance curb appeal.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of work, the types of finishes available, and any preparation needed before the pouring process begins to ensure the finished surface meets their needs and complements their landscape.
Before requesting pathway pouring, homeowners should consider factors such as the desired size and shape of the pathway, the load it will need to support, and the overall design aesthetic. It’s also helpful to understand the importance of proper site preparation, drainage considerations, and the use of appropriate reinforcement to ensure durability. Clear communication about these aspects can help achieve a functional and visually appealing result that aligns with the property's layout and usage requirements.

Pathway Pouring Questions
What is pathway pouring? Pathway pouring involves creating a concrete surface for walkways, patios, or driveways, providing a durable and smooth finish.
What types of projects are suitable for pathway pouring? It is ideal for residential walkways, garden paths, patios, and other outdoor surfaces requiring a sturdy, even surface.
How should I prepare for pathway pouring? The area should be cleared and leveled, with proper drainage considerations and a stable base to ensure a long-lasting surface.
What materials are used in pathway pouring? Typically, concrete is used, often reinforced with wire mesh or rebar for added strength and longevity.
